How to see it
HIP 7357 has a visual magnitude of about 6.77: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.
Sky position
Equatorial coordinates for HIP 7357: right ascension 1h 34m 49s, declination +0° 56′ 37″ (J2000), in the region of the Cetus constellation (IAU figure Cet).
